It is not DTS-HDMA, for a few reasons. One is similar to Hal, not all sources used were at that quality, but the larger reason for me was simply I was not able to find a workflow in FCP7 that was within my abilities and patience (FCP is limited in the audio formats that it can render in program, and with the thousands of audio cuts I made and testing and re-clipping etc..., there was simply no way I could have completed the project before throwing my computer out the window or getting fit for a straight jacket.

Regarding the two tracks, one is primary, the other is an alternate audio ending for the close of the movie, otherwise they are identical. If you downloaded the BD25 then the primary one is my preferred/favorite, but the alternate audio track is for purists who would rather the traditional 'crash' of the theme as the screen does an iris wipe to the credits.
